.vipMemberContainer{display:block;font-family:var(--font_roboto);color:var(--clr_white);max-width:1420px;margin:130px auto 40px}.vipBannerWrapper img{width:100%;height:auto}.deskBecomeVipBannerSection{margin-bottom:32px;display:block}.deskVipBannerSection{display:block}.mobBecomeVipBannerSection,.mobVipBannerSection{display:none}.vipBannerWrapper{position:relative}.benefitsRewardsSection{text-align:center}.benefitsRewardsCardSection{display:flex;justify-content:space-between;gap:16px;margin:16px 0}.benefitsRewardsCardSection .benefitsRewardsCardWrapper{position:relative;display:flex;align-items:center;width:100%;height:auto;overflow:hidden;padding:1px;border-radius:8px}.benefitsRewardsCardSection .benefitsRewardsCardWrapper .borderRotateAnimate{display:flex;align-items:center;justify-content:space-between;padding:4px 35px;width:100%;height:100%;border-radius:8px;position:relative;overflow:hidden}.benefitsRewardsCardSection .benefitsRewardsCardWrapper .borderRotateAnimate:after{content:"";position:absolute;background-image:url(https://d3htdx7djhryaf.cloudfront.net/rjm/v2/assets/mainPages/images/vip/vipBannerWaves.png);background-position:50%;background-repeat:no-repeat;background-size:cover;width:100%;left:0;height:135px;opacity:.1;top:0}.benefitsRewardsCardWrapper:first-child .borderRotateAnimate{background:linear-gradient(105.75deg,#394e82 3.63%,#0d0048 97.18%)}.benefitsRewardsCardWrapper:nth-child(2) .borderRotateAnimate{background:linear-gradient(105.58deg,#524319 7.43%,#362800 98.07%);justify-content:start;gap:50px}.benefitsRewardsCardWrapper:nth-child(3) .borderRotateAnimate{background:linear-gradient(105.75deg,#1b1641 3.63%,#242055 97.18%);padding-right:4px}.benefitsRewardsCardWrapper:first-child:before{content:"";position:absolute;top:0;left:0;width:100%;height:1px;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.4) 50%,transparent);pointer-events:none}.benefitsRewardsCardWrapper:first-child:after{content:"";position:absolute;bottom:0;left:-100px;width:100%;height:1px;background:linear-gradient(-63deg,transparent,hsla(0,0%,100%,.4) 50%,transparent);pointer-events:none}.benefitsRewardsCardWrapper:nth-child(2):before{content:"";position:absolute;top:0;left:-50px;width:100%;height:1px;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.4) 50%,transparent);pointer-events:none}.benefitsRewardsCardWrapper:nth-child(2):after{content:"";position:absolute;bottom:0;left:50px;width:100%;height:1px;background:linear-gradient(-63deg,transparent,hsla(0,0%,100%,.4) 50%,transparent);pointer-events:none}.benefitsRewardsCardWrapper:nth-child(3):before{content:"";position:absolute;top:0;left:-50px;width:100%;height:1px;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.4) 50%,transparent);pointer-events:none}.benefitsRewardsCardWrapper:nth-child(3):after{content:"";position:absolute;bottom:0;left:100px;width:100%;height:1px;background:linear-gradient(-63deg,transparent,hsla(0,0%,100%,.4) 50%,transparent);pointer-events:none}.benefitsRewardsCardWrapper img{max-width:120px;height:auto}.benefitsRewardsTitle{font-size:22px;text-align:left;max-width:150px}.benefitsRewardsCardWrapper:nth-child(3) .benefitsRewardsTitle{max-width:220px}.deskBecomeVipBannerSection .vipTextImg{left:12%;max-width:500px}.vipBannerSection .vipTextImg{left:17%;max-width:360px}.vipBannerWrapper .vipTextImg{position:absolute;margin:auto;text-align:center;color:#84591e;top:40%}.vipTextImg .vipTextOne{font-size:34px;font-family:Russo One,sans-serif;margin-bottom:12px}.vipTextImg .vipTextTwo{font-size:24px}.vipHeaderWrapper{margin:16px 0}.vipHeaderWrapper h3{font-size:24px}.benefitsRewardsHeadingTitle{font-size:20px;margin-bottom:8px}.vipMemberContentWrapper .modalTitleInfo{font-size:24px;padding-bottom:12px;font-family:var(--font_roboto)}.benefitsRewardsHeadingTitle,.vipMemberContentWrapper .modalTitleInfo{background:radial-gradient(35.9% 35.9% at 50% 50%,#f5e4c8 0,#d7a75a 100%);-webkit-background-clip:text;background-clip:text;color:transparent;font-weight:600;text-transform:uppercase}.benefitsRewardsHeadingSubTitle{font-weight:500;margin-bottom:8px}.benefitsRewardsHeadingDesc{margin-bottom:24px;color:var(--clr_gray)}.vipBarImg{max-width:280px}.vipDetailsSection{background:linear-gradient(89.57deg,rgba(139,94,26,0) 10.22%,rgba(139,94,26,.5) 49.98%,rgba(139,94,26,0) 88.94%);padding:20px 0;margin-bottom:24px}.vipDetailsSection h4{text-align:center;font-size:20px;font-weight:600;margin-bottom:34px}.vipContactSection{position:relative}.vipMemberDetailsWrapper{display:flex;justify-content:center;gap:40px}.vipMemberDetailsWrapper .vipNameSection{text-align:right}.vipMemberDetailsWrapper .lineShadow{width:2px;background:linear-gradient(0deg,hsla(0,0%,100%,.02),#ffb703 50%,rgba(253,186,67,0))}.vipMemberDetailsWrapper .vipDetailsTitle{font-size:14px;margin-bottom:8px}.vipMemberDetailsWrapper .vipDetailsContent{color:#d7a75a;font-weight:600;text-transform:uppercase;display:flex;gap:12px}.vipMemberDetailsWrapper .vipNumberCopy{cursor:pointer}.vipContactSection .copiedDivShow{position:absolute;display:none;height:auto;background:#283b23;border-radius:4px;padding:8px;bottom:-7px;left:100%;margin-left:10px;max-height:36px}.copyDivContent{display:flex;gap:10px;flex-direction:row;color:green;align-items:center;justify-content:center;height:100%;font-size:14px}.vipMemberModalContent.mainModalInside{width:480px;position:relative;border-radius:12px}.vipMemberModalContent:before{content:"";position:absolute;background-image:url(https://d3htdx7djhryaf.cloudfront.net/rjm/v2/assets/mainPages/images/vip/vipPopup.png);width:100%;height:160px;background-repeat:no-repeat;background-size:cover;top:0;left:0}.vipMemberContentWrapper{margin:150px 0 0;text-align:center}.viewDetailsBtn{width:100%;margin-top:24px;font-weight:800;text-transform:uppercase}.vipMemberPopup .vipBarImg{margin:16px 0}.vipMemberContentWrapper ul{list-style-type:disc;text-align:left;margin:auto;width:260px}.vipMemberContentWrapper p{font-size:15px;color:var(--clr_white)}.vipMemberContentWrapper ul li{color:var(--clr_yellow);font-size:18px;font-weight:300}.vipMemberContentWrapper ul li:not(:last-child){margin-bottom:12px}.deskVipBannerSection .vipBannerWrapper .vipTextImg{max-width:320px;left:17%}.no-overflow{overflow:hidden}@media screen and (max-width:1279px){.vipHeaderWrapper h3{font-size:20px}.mobBecomeVipBannerSection{margin-bottom:24px}.vipMemberContainer{margin:160px 16px 16px}.vipBannerWrapper .vipTextImg{top:10%;left:10%;right:10%}.deskBecomeVipBannerSection,.deskVipBannerSection{display:none}.mobBecomeVipBannerSection,.mobVipBannerSection{display:block}.benefitsRewardsHeadingTitle{font-size:18px}.benefitsRewardsHeadingSubTitle,.benefitsRewardsTitle{font-size:16px}.vipTextImg .vipTextOne{font-size:34px}.benefitsRewardsHeadingDesc,.vipMemberContentWrapper ul li{font-size:14px}.vipTextImg .vipTextTwo{font-size:18px;max-width:250px;margin:auto}.benefitsRewardsCardSection{flex-direction:column;max-width:600px;margin:16px auto}.benefitsRewardsCardWrapper:nth-child(3) .benefitsRewardsTitle,.benefitsRewardsTitle{font-weight:600;max-width:160px}.benefitsRewardsCardWrapper img{max-width:100px;height:auto}.benefitsRewardsCardSection .benefitsRewardsCardWrapper{padding:1px}.benefitsRewardsCardWrapper:nth-child(3){padding-right:4px}.benefitsRewardsCardWrapper:nth-child(2){justify-content:space-between}.vipModalInnerWrapper{margin:0 16px;width:auto}.vipMemberContentWrapper .modalTitleInfo{font-size:18px}.vipMemberContentWrapper p{font-size:13px;line-height:18px}}@media screen and (max-width:580px){.vipMemberContainer{margin:150px 16px 16px}.vipMemberContentWrapper{margin:130px 32px 32px}.benefitsRewardsCardSection .benefitsRewardsCardWrapper{padding:1px}.vipTextImg .vipTextOne{font-size:16px}.vipTextImg .vipTextTwo{font-size:13px;max-width:190px}.vipMemberModalContent.mainModalInside{width:92%}.vipContactSection .copiedDivShow{top:auto;left:auto;bottom:auto;margin-top:4px}.vipMemberContentWrapper ul{width:240px}.benefitsRewardsCardWrapper:first-child:after{left:-50px}.benefitsRewardsCardWrapper:nth-child(3):after{left:50px}}@media screen and (max-width:480px){.vipMemberContainer{margin:130px 16px 16px}.vipBannerWrapper .vipTextImg{top:5%}}@media screen and (max-width:370px){.vipMemberContentWrapper{margin:90px 0 0}.vipMemberModalContent:before{height:135px}}@media(max-width:359px){.vipBarImg{width:240px}.vipMemberContentWrapper ul{width:200px}}